Costs Associated with Starting a Snow Plowing Business

Before you can start your snow plowing business, you’ll need to purchase the necessary equipment. Depending on the size of the area you plan to service, you may need a truck or SUV, a snow plow, and other tools such as shovels and ice-melt. You may also need to invest in additional safety gear such as chains, boots, and reflective clothing.

In addition to purchasing equipment, you’ll also need to obtain insurance coverage for your business. Liability insurance is a must, as it will protect you from any damages that may occur while plowing. You may also want to consider getting workers’ compensation coverage if you plan to hire employees.

Researching Local Laws and Regulations

Before you can start offering snow plowing services, you’ll need to research local laws and regulations. Depending on where you live, you may need to obtain a special license or permit to operate your business. Make sure you understand what types of licenses and permits are required in your area and how long it will take to obtain them.

You should also familiarize yourself with zoning laws in your area. Some communities have restrictions on the type of businesses that can operate in certain areas. Make sure you know what types of businesses are allowed in your neighborhood before you start advertising your services.

Marketing Strategies

Once you’ve obtained the necessary licenses and permits to operate your business, it’s time to start marketing your services. The best way to reach potential customers is through direct mail. Create attractive flyers or postcards and distribute them in your target area. You can also use online advertising platforms such as Google Ads or Facebook Ads to reach a wider audience.

Don’t forget the power of word-of-mouth referrals. Ask family and friends to spread the word about your business. You may even want to offer discounts or other incentives to those who refer new customers.

Managing Business Operations

When running a snow plowing business, customer service is key. Make sure you respond quickly to customer inquiries, and provide them with estimates as soon as possible. Establish a billing system that works for you and your customers, and make sure you collect payments promptly.

Another important aspect of running a snow plowing business is scheduling. Make sure you have enough staff and equipment to handle large orders, and develop a system for tracking appointments and invoices.

Pricing Strategy

When it comes to setting prices for your services, it’s important to remain competitive. Research the rates other snow plowing businesses in your area are charging, and adjust your rates accordingly. At the same time, make sure you’re still making a profit. Consider offering discounts for bulk orders or long-term contracts.
